Corn and shrimp stir-fry with scallions is a popular snack dish, favored by many young people and commonly found from street vendors, especially in the old quarter. On rainy days, a plate of hot and spicy corn and shrimp stir-fry becomes even more enticing. Keeping up with the trend, Viet Pho Restaurant has innovated by replacing shrimp with dried shrimp while still preserving the distinctive flavor of the dish.
Ingredients:
- Glutinous corn (or sweet corn): 2 ears
- Dried shrimp: 50 grams
- Scallions, dried shallots, cooking oil, butter, seasoning salt

Dried shrimp can be replaced with dried shrimp according to the preference and taste of each family
How to Make Corn and Shrimp Stir-Fry:
Step 1:
- Purchase corn, remove kernels, rub to clean, then wash twice with water and drain.
- Peel and wash dried shallots, then finely chop.
- Pick and wash fresh scallion leaves, removing roots, old leaves, and wilted leaves, then finely chop.

Step 2:
- Place a pot of water on the stove, add a teaspoon of salt. Bring water to a boil, then blanch the corn for about 2-3 minutes, then drain in a colander to remove excess water.
- Heat a skillet on the stove, add a tablespoon of cooking oil and heat it up, then start adding the dried shrimp and stir-fry.

- Season with spices to taste, then set aside the shrimp on a separate plate.
- Add another tablespoon of cooking oil to the pan, then sauté the finely chopped dried shallots until fragrant. Continue to add the corn and stir-fry thoroughly, season with spices to taste.
- When the corn firms up, add 5g of butter and stir-fry evenly for fragrance. Then turn off the heat, add the scallions and previously sautéed dried shrimp, and stir evenly. Transfer the corn and shrimp stir-fry to a plate and serve immediately while hot with chili sauce.

The fragrant chewiness of corn, combined with the saltiness of dried shrimp, the richness of butter, and a hint of spiciness from the chili sauce, truly make this dish irresistible. Wishing you all success!
